It has increasingly become necessary for general practitioners to be proficient in periodontal surgery, especially on examination and diagnosis. Periodontal surgical techniques are not routinely taught in dental school. This course is designed to enhance and develop the practitioner’s skills in basic and advanced periodontal flap surgery. The surgical procedures taught will provide a clear understanding of each procedure. Upon completion of this course, you will have acquired the critical skills to perform periodontal surgery in your clinical practice. Live surgery will also be performed to improve the learning experience.

Prof. Dr. Sunil Kumar Nettemu
Prof. Dr. Sunil Kumar Nettemu has completed his Masters in Periodontology and holds a Fellowship, Mastership and Diplomate in Oral Implantology from the International Congress of Oral Implantologist (ICOI), USA. He has been working passionately and extensively in the field of Oral Implantology for many years and is currently holding the prestigious position as the ICOI Director and Membership Chairman for India And ASEAN Nations.
He is also a member of ICOI Ambassadors’ Circle and the ICOI Advanced credentialing committee member. He has research grant on his name for research work in the field of Implant Dentistry. He heads the Department of Periodontics and Oral Implantology and is the Co-ordinator for Fellowship in Oral Implantology post – graduate certification programme at Centre for Excellence, Faculty of Dentistry, Melaka – Manipal Medical College, Malaysia.
He widely practices the use of various hard and soft tissue augmentation techniques for implant site preparation in achieving finer aesthetics, restore function and enhance patient comfort. He has delivered numerous talks on Periodontology and Oral Implantology as invited speaker on National and International podiums. He has numerous journal and book publications in the field of Periodontology, Implant Dentistry and advanced surgical practices.
He believes in inspiring budding dental practitioners and Implantologist to be passionate about their work and deliver quality dental care to all patients.
Prof. Dr. Sowmya Nettem
Prof. Dr. Sowmya Nettem completed her Bachelor of Dental Surgery (BDS) from Dr. MGR Medical University in 2005 and Master in Dental Surgery (MDS) in Periodontology and Oral Implantology in 2009 from SRM University, India with a Gold Medal and First Rank certificate for Excellence in Education. She is the first dental faculty member from Malaysia to obtain FAIMER fellowship in Healthcare Professionals Education.
She has completed Standard Proficiency certification in Laser Dentistry from Academy of Laser Dentistry, USA and is a speaker for various workshops on this subject. She has organized and facilitated numerous workshops in the field of Periodontology, Oral Implantology as well as Healthcare Professionals Education. She has numerous publications in indexed, peer reviewed journals, books and is actively involved in guiding research projects for undergraduate dental students. Currently, she works as professor in the Department of Periodontics at Melaka – Manipal Medical College, Malaysia where she also actively works with the Implant team to conduct post-graduate certificate course for general dental practitioners across Malaysia.
As the Chairman of Integrated CBL committee, she is the pioneer member to implement Integrated Case-Based Learning at her Institution. She is a core member and secretary of the Medical Education Unit at her Institution which organizes faculty development programs and workshops to help all the faculty members stay abreast with the latest developments in the field of Healthcare Professionals Education.
